One of the most notable aspects of the Ehsaas Program is its focus on empowering women. Let’s face it, women often bear the brunt of economic hardships, especially in patriarchal societies. The program includes several components aimed at giving women the tools they need to succeed. From financial aid through Ehsaas Kafaalat to scholarships and interest-free loans, the initiative is all about leveling the playing field.
And it’s not just about women—low-income families across the board are getting a helping hand. Whether it’s through cash transfers, access to education, or healthcare services, the program is making sure that the most vulnerable segments of society aren’t left out in the cold.

Of course, no government program is without its challenges, and the Ehsaas Program is no exception. Ensuring fair distribution of resources is a significant hurdle. There have been concerns about fraud, with some people managing to slip through the cracks and get benefits they aren’t entitled to. However, the government is working on tightening controls to minimize these issues.
Another challenge is making sure that the help gets to those who need it the most. In a country as vast and diverse as Pakistan, this is easier said than done. Despite these obstacles, the program has made significant strides in improving the socio-economic conditions of the country’s poorest citizens.
Now, let’s get to the juicy part—what’s new with the 8171 Ehsaas Program and BISP for 2024? The government has announced that deserving members who are already receiving stipends will continue to get their payments. Starting January 1, 2024, an amount of 8500 PKR will be transferred to beneficiaries’ accounts. It’s all part of the government’s ongoing efforts to keep the helping hand extended to those in need.
But that’s not all. There’s also an exciting update about Taleemi Wazaif (educational stipends) for children. In 2024, 15,000 children will each receive 20,000 PKR in Taleemi Wazaif. This is a significant step forward in ensuring that the next generation has the educational opportunities they need to succeed. The stipends had been delayed, but now the government is making good on its promise to support deserving students under the Kafaalat Program.
